KPCS Delay Filter Assembly
(ADFA-1850/80-A1)



Passband : 1810 ~ 1890MHz
Passband Insertion Loss : 1.2dB Max.
Passband Loss Flatness : 0.1dB Max.
Passband Return Loss : 23dB Min.(all ports)
Input to Output Delay : (10.0nS ~15.0nS)
Passband Delay Flatness : 0.1nS
Passband phase Linearity : 0.5 p-p Max. over any 20MHz
segment in passband

Coupler Characteristics Isolation
J1 to J3 : 30dB ± 0.5dB J3 to J2 : 48dB Min
J4 to J2 : 11dB ± 0.5dB J1 to J4 : 28dB Min.
J1 to J5 : 30dB ± 0.5dB J5 to J2 : 48dB Min.
J2 to J6 : 30dB ± 1.5dB J1 to J6 : 48dB Min
Flatness : ± 0.1db J4 to J5 : 39dB Min.
Power rating : CW 100 watts
Third Order IMD : -80dBc maximum
Test condition : Two +43dBm tones applied at J1 with 5MHz carrier separation, measured at J2
with all ports terminated with low IMD loads w/minimum 20dB return loss.
Operating Temperature : -35C to +95C
Dimension : 200mm*80mm*33mm
